THE STORY OF THE MOUNTAIN BIGFOOT
One day in 1997, I agreed to help my friend Dave move his stuff to southern LA. Houma LA to be specific. Now keep in mind that this should have been a simple 5 hour trip, but when Dave is involved, nothing ever goes as planned. First off, some (This word is unacceptable on Trapperman)-monkey convinced him that it would be quicker to go from Clarksville TN to Houma LA by going east to Chattanooga and then cutting the GA/AL corner. Everything went pretty smooth all of the way through Chattanooga other than the fact Chattanooga is a filthy (This word is unacceptable on Trapperman)-hole filled with disgusting people. Or at least it was that day. We made it down to this area somewhere in the GA/AL corner which was mountains on both sides. Sheer rock walls covered in chain link fence so boulders will roll down and stay at the bottom of the road cut instead of making some station wagon full of little tricycle motors into a flat blob of blood and motor oil. The scenery was really cool, however, the road grade was very steep. It was easy to start to go too fast for the 10,000 hairpin turns the road made each mile. In one mountain valley we were driving through, there were a lot of deer which seemed bound and determined to kill themselves on my bumper. Now keep in mind that I am driving a Ryder truck, the biggest one they rent out, which is filled with about 15,000 dollars worth of antiques not to mention the household goods. Having to put the brakes on too fast could be disastrous to the contents. As we drive along, I am driving, Dave is asleep in the passenger seat. A small group of deer bolts out in front of us and I am forced to brake a little harder than I am comfortable with. Dave wakes up and says “What in the (This word is unacceptable on Trapperman) is going on” I explain the deer and he reminds me about the $15,000 worth of his wife’s antiques in the back. I respond with “No (This word is unacceptable on Trapperman), would you rather I smoke a deer and cause us to be forced to wait for another truck?” He didn’t. Dave goes back to sleep and I continue to drive down this mountain. I come to a gentle curve with a wonderful view of a huge mountain valley. There is a wall to the left and woods and scenery to the right. All of a sudden that is not the only thing I can see. Now there is this great big hairy thing about 7 foot tall standing in the road just inside of the white line. Just as I put my foot on the brakes, Dave wakes up and sees this thing 10 feet in front of him. Dave screams at the top of his lungs, as he is running up the back side of the seat with his (This word is unacceptable on Trapperman)-cheeks, “WHAT IN THE (This word is unacceptable on Trapperman) IS THAT HAIRY MOTHER (This word is unacceptable on Trapperman)!!!!!!!!!!” Now picture a 230 pound southern Louisiana coon-(This word is unacceptable on Trapperman) with the accent to match screaming this out. I hit the brakes so as to not hit whatever this thing is. Everything in the back of the truck slid forward at a rapid pace. Much faster than the front of the truck is moving. We could hear stuff breaking, but can not do anything about it. In retrospect I should have run the son of a (This word is unacceptable on Trapperman) down. It would have been a lot cheaper in the long run. We get to Houma where the (This word is unacceptable on Trapperman) is about to hit the fan. Now we have to explain to Sandy, his wife, that we destroyed her antiques, some of which were 200 years old and older because we didn’t want to hit a bigfoot. Naturally she thinks that we are out of our minds. She thinks that we are completely full of (This word is unacceptable on Trapperman) and that we are morons because we could not come up with a better story than ---BIGFOOT. In the end, the damage was totaled up to around $10,000. Sandy was (This word is unacceptable on Trapperman), the insurance company was (This word is unacceptable on Trapperman). Both Dave and I look like assholes to all of the above, and we have no proof of anything. I don’t believe in bigfoot. I think it is all a bunch of crap. Yet, how in the (This word is unacceptable on Trapperman) do I explain a bigfoot stepping out into the highway in front of me and seeing it clear as day? Everyone wanted to accuse us of drunk driving, drugs, stupidity, and about every other thing they could think of. Neither one of us had had a drop of alcohol neither had either of us been under the influence of any drug. I was wide awake and alert with no fatigue. Think what you want, I saw it, a god-(This word is unacceptable on Trapperman) bigfoot. I still don’t believe in bigfoot, but what in the (This word is unacceptable on Trapperman) was it? Some tard dressed up like bigfoot? A dummy? Something was there. Two people saw it. I think Dave pooped in his pants at least a little. Maybe I should have run it down. At least then I would have a body. If it was some tard in a costume, Darwin would have claimed his rights. If it was some sort of undiscovered beast, I could have held the carcass for ransom for any amount I wanted. Either way, in the end, all I have is a story which most people who are rational think is bullshit or the ramblings of a (This word is unacceptable on Trapperman).
